DREAMS
1. Usually occurs during sleep periods.
2. It appears about 65 times in the Old Testament.
a) The most significant use of this word, however, is with reference to
prophetic “dreams” and/or “visions.”
b) Both true and false prophets claimed to communicate with God by
these dreams and visions.
c) True and false prophets could have dreams; the only difference is true
prophet’s dreams were expected to come true and a proclaimed
dream not coming to pass could lead to loss of life for the proclaiming
prophet (Deut. 18)
Deuteronomy 13:1
“If a prophet or a dreamer of dreams arises among you and gives you a sign or a
wonder, ….
d) Not only prophets in the Bible had dreams but the dreams recorded
were GOD speaking.
e) First recorded dream was Abimelech in Gen. 20:3 when GOD told him
to give back Abrahams wife. So, GOD can give instructions/warnings
to even unbelievers through dreams.
Genesis 20:3
But God came to Abimelech in a dream by night and said to him, “Behold, you are
a dead man because of the woman whom you have taken, for she is a man's wife.”

3. It Appears several times in the New Testament (Matthew, Acts, Jude 1:8)
a) In Acts 2 the Apostle Peter helps us understand that the prophecy given
by the Prophet Joel (Joel 2) is coming to pass in our times, in the times of
THE HOLY SPIRIT. He is telling us that dreams a valid means of hearing
from GOD just as well as visions are because GOD had promised this to
HIS people.
Acts 2:17
“‘In the last days, God says, I will pour out my Spirit on all people. Your sons and
daughters will prophesy, your young men will see visions, your old men will dream
dreams.
b) Jude uses it to describe non-Christians, they use their dreams and the
interpretation for excuses to do all sorts of things. Hence interpretation
is very important.
c) Before the coming of THE HOLY SPIRIT to the world, only prophets had
the Word of GOD, but after HE came with Power, HE equipped every
single child of GOD with the ability to hear GOD for themselves and not
"need" a prophet to bring them the Word of GOD.
Hebrews 1:1-2
Long ago, at many times and in many ways, God spoke to our fathers by the
prophets, but in these last days he has spoken to us by his Son ...

4. Dreams are not visions or trances. They are not flashes either, they only take
place when a person is asleep. Daydreaming does not count. The idea of a dream
is that you have no involvement at all, your mind is a watcher so you don't
usually control it.

5. Dreams are sometimes called Visions of the night.


a) A vision of the night could also be a vision you see when you are very
sleepy, not entirely asleep but just at the end then THE LORD gives you
HIS message.
b) Mostly used Visions of the Night in the New Testament. Paul had a lot of
them.
PURPOSE OF DREAMS
1. Many worries
Ecclesiastes 5:3
A dream comes when there are many cares, …
a) Some dreams are from the cares and worries you have on your mind,
some come from the pizza you ate.
2. Primary instruction/Information.
Job 33:14-18
For God speaks in one way, and in two, though man does not perceive it.
In a dream, in a vision of the night, when deep sleep falls on men, while they slumber
on their beds, then he opens the ears of men and terrifies them with warnings, that
he may turn man aside from his deed and conceal pride from a man; he keeps back
his soul from the pit, his life from perishing by the sword.
a) Some dreams are direct
b) Some dreams need interpretation
c) Some dreams you remember
d) Some dreams I don't believe you need to remember, I believe THE
LORD buries them in you for a later season or uses them as
subconscious instructions. Later you have de ja vu situations or
remember something vaguely, wiser, etc.
DREAM INTERPRETATION – THE FULL WISDOM OF GOD
The Wisdom of GOD is all encompassing, seeing a vision, having a dream or a Word
is not the end of the world. It is just the beginning of the journey.
Proverbs 3:19-20
The Lord by wisdom founded the earth; by understanding he established the
heavens; by his knowledge the deeps broke open, and the clouds drop down the
dew.

Proverbs 24:3-4
By wisdom a house is built, and by understanding it is established; by knowledge
the rooms are filled with all precious and pleasant riches.

So, the full wisdom of GOD can be broken into 3. We'll use Pharaoh's dream and
Joseph's interpretation as an example:
1. Revelation/Wisdom: the dream, vision, Word that was given. Sometimes it is
very direct and other times it is very vague.
In Acts 16, Paul saw a man from Macedonia calling him; In Genesis 20,
Abimelech had a real-life conversation with GOD. No need for any
interpretation.
In Genesis 41, when Pharaoh had his dream they were extremely unclear and
the Wisdom of GOD was required to bring revelation. It was so tough even the
devil couldn't decipher!
2. Interpretation/Understanding: the dream gets an interpretation here and it can
be extremely clear if you can get the full revelation. Joseph told Pharaoh the
entire mind of GOD and it was so clear and resonated with the king. Daniel too
interpreted a dream for Nebuchadnezzar.
3. Action/Knowledge: it is one thing to know the interpretation of your dream,
but what would you do with it? So, you know there will 7 good years followed
by 7 bad years, what do you do? Do you pray for 7 bad years to be erased? Do
you build barns and store up wheat? What do you do? That is where knowledge
comes in, the application of the interpreted wisdom.
Of course, sometimes you file it away in your heart like Mary did with hers but the
filing away was more like preparation for what was coming. There must always be
an action, even if it is deliberate filing away.
DREAM INTERPRETATION- FINDING INTERPRETATION
1. GOD gives the Wisdom, Interpretation and the Action. It is all in HIS Hand and
you can seek HIM for it. HE gives all who ask. James 1:5-8, Daniel 2.
2. Culture: some cultures have some basic interpretations. Yoruba people believe
if someone gives you a house in a dream that means you will never buy a house.
This is not always the case, GOD gives Wisdom not culture. The devil has invaded
culture and even JESUS condemns it. Matthew 15.
3. Books/Google: recommended to go to GOD but if you find strong spiritual
Christians you know you can use their material. All revelation comes from GOD,
nothing is set in stone.
4. Counsellors: strong spiritual counsellors can be used but again GOD is speaking
to YOU.
5. Mediums/astrology: these have no place in the life a Christian, the kings that
did this in the Bible died (Saul in Samuel 28, Ahaziah in 2 Kings 1).
